I've noticed that too. I think you should really give credit to the ones doing the icons in the first place.

Even better, although I'm pretty sure all you had was good intentions and willingness to share something with the community, it would be wise to not post such "compilation packs" without the permission of the artists in the first place.

As a matter of fact, at another modding community for another game, there's a strict rule to not include any artwork done by others in the packed .zip files, but instead list the required items as "dependancies" with links to the place to obtain these files, associated to each dependancy.

dj_anion
Apr 29, 2006, 05:39 AM
Sizes of original pics are very various. Sometimes they are very similar to the output size. Output size is 64×64. It is necessary to use some extra filters for better quality.

I am using Adobe Photoshop CS with nVidia plugin for DDS output format. Nothing more.

Thanks for the quick reply...

by playing around I found out how to do it:

find a good pic that is relatively small

then either make it 128x128 or 256x256 (if you cant get a small pic to work with) - which ever size is closer to your original size

It appears CIV4 autosizes it once its in the game


the only problem I have is that it is a pain to test the pics since you have to load up the game to see if the pics turn out okay :crazyeye:


but I got it working ...thx!
